U.S. President Donald Trump may invite North Korean leader Kim Jong-un to a follow-up summit

at his Mar-a-Lago resort in Florida,... if the two leaders hit it off in Singapore.

While no other information was given on the possibility of a follow-up summit at the Palm

Beach resort,... unnamed White House officials said it could happen this fall.

President Trump has invited a number of world leaders to his resort before,... including

Chinese President Xi Jinping and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e.

Fox News host Jeanine Pirro wants to replace Attorney General Jeff Sessions as the country's

top law enforcement official, according to a report.

Pirro first expressed interest in the role during transition, even pushing her candidacy

for deputy attorney general when it was clear that Sessions was the Trump administration's

first choice, according to Politico.

But two White House aides told the news outlet they believed President Trump was not seriously

considering nominating her for the position, despite his public vexation with Sessions

over his decision to recuse himself from overseeing the Justice Department's federal Russia

investigation.

The White House declined to comment to Politico, and Pirro did not respond to press inquiries.

The news comes as Pirro's influence with Trump has grown, and he continues to appoint

cable news personalities to administration posts.

Pirro, a fervent Trump supporter, has also stepped up her attacks on Sessions during

her Saturday evening show, "Justice with Jeanine."

In March, Pirro condemned Sessions for not reopening the probe into former Secretary

of State Hillary Clinton once he took office.

While guest hosting "Hannity," Pirro suggested Sessions had "lost his prosecutorial balls"

while serving in the U.S. Senate to explain why he hadn't appointed a second special

counsel to investigate Clinton's use of a private email server and her involvement

in the Uranium One controversy.

In addition, she met with Trump in the Oval Office in November to discuss the idea of

a special counsel to probe Clinton.

"Everything I said to President Trump is exactly what I've vocalized on my show,

'Justice with Jeanine,'" Pirro told the New York Times at the time.

Prior to joining Fox News in 2006, Pirro was the first woman elected as a Westchester County

Court judge in New York in 1990, having previously served as the county's assistant district

attorney.

She unsuccessfully ran as a Republican Party candidate for New York attorney general and

the state's U.S. Senate seat in 2006.

President Trump took to Twitter on Monday morning to unequivocally assert that he has

the "absolute right" to pardon himself should Robert Mueller's "witch hunt" attempt to bring

charges against him.

But, the president added, he shouldn't have to because he's done "nothing wrong."

"As has been stated by numerous legal scholars, I have the absolute right to PARDON myself,

but why would I do that when I have done nothing wrong?" said Trump.

"In the meantime, the never ending Witch Hunt, led by 13 very Angry and Conflicted Democrats

(& others) continues into the mid-terms!"Trump's comments were in part prompted by the publication

by The New York Times of a confidential letter sent by the president's lawyers in January

to Mueller arguing that the president's broad executive authority means he cannot be charged

with obstruction of justice.

The Times reports:

President Trump's lawyers have for months quietly waged a campaign to keep the special

counsel from trying to force him to answer questions in the investigation into whether

he obstructed justice, asserting that he cannot be compelled to testify and arguing in a confidential

letter that he could not possibly have committed obstruction because he has unfettered authority

over all federal investigations.

In a brash assertion of presidential power, the 20-page letter — sent to the special

counsel, Robert S. Mueller III, and obtained by The New York Times — contends that the

president cannot illegally obstruct any aspect of the investigation into Russia's election

meddling because the Constitution empowers him to, "if he wished, terminate the inquiry,

or even exercise his power to pardon."

On Sunday, New York City Mayor Rudy Giuliani told ABC's "This Week" that he thinks Trump

"probably does" have the power to pardon himself.

"He probably does," Giuliani told host George Stephanopoulis on Sunday.

"He has no intention of pardoning himself but he probably — not to say he can't.

I mean, that — that's another really interesting constitutional argument, can the president

pardon himself?

It would be an open question.

I think it would probably get answered, by gosh, that's what the constitution says

and if you want to change it, change it.

But yes."

Though Giuliani expressed confidence that Trump could "probably" do it, he admitted

that the "political ramifications" of doing so would be "tough."

"Pardoning other people is one thing.

Pardoning yourself is another," he said.

"Other presidents have pardoned people in circumstances like this both — both in their

administration and sometimes the next president, even of a different party will come along

and pardon."

The Asian city-state of Singapore will be one of the most highly secure zones in the world when Donald Trump, the US president, and Kim Jong-un meet next Tuesday, and on the frontline of the forces protecting the two leaders will be the fearsome Gurkha warriors of Nepal

  The Gurkha Contingent has long served as a low-profile presence within Singapore's elite police force, and last weekend could already be seen patrolling the streets of the normally placid island and standing guard outside a meeting of defence ministers at the downtown Shangri-la hotel

  "They are the people who guard our VVIPs and in heightened alert situations you would even see Gurkhas out patrolling in key installations

The leaders of Canada and France say they will use the upcoming G7 summit to confront

their U.S. counterpart Donald Trump on trade, urging other G7 members to do the same.

For more on this and other international news we turn to our Ro Aram…

What did the two leaders have to say?

Well Mark…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au and French President Emmanuel Macron

took a confrontational tone towards Trump.

They were speaking side by side on Parliament Hill in Ottawa a day ahead of Friday's G7

summit in Canada.

Macron suggested Washington's protectionist measures were leading to what he described

as a new U.S. "hegemony."

"The United States are naturally a great economic power, but if they continue towards a form

of isolationism, brutal hegemony, of distancing themselves from their own history, from their

own values, from the role they play in international organizations - where they are leaders - by

deciding to remove themselves, that will be bad for the United States of America."

Both leaders also said President Trump's recent decision to impose tariffs on steel and aluminum

imports was illegal and also harmful to the American people.

"It is American jobs which will be lost because of the actions of the United States and its

administration."

Trump fired back by tweeting France and Canada were hurting the United States with unfair

trade practices and imposing what he called "massive tariffs" on American imports.

The upcoming summit between the U.S. and North Korea was a key focus of Thursday's meeting

between President Donald Trump and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e.

If the summit goes well, Trump said he would invite North Korean leader Kim Jong-un to

the White House.

"Certainly, if it goes well.

And I think it would be well-received.

I think he would look at it very favorably.

So I think that could happen."

If the summit doesn't go well, Trump said his administration has a list of over 300

additional sanctions the U.S. could levy against North Korea.

The Trump administration has frequently used the phrase "maximum pressure" when talking

about the reclusive nation, but it's softened its tone in light of the upcoming summit,

the president says.

"You'll know how well we do in the negotiation.

If you hear me saying we're going to use maximum pressure, you'll know the negotiation did

not do well."
